Window color laws are developed as a safety and security concern for vehicle drivers to see various other vehicles much better when driving, and for regulation enforcement police officers as they come close to a cars and truck. When establishing just how much to tint home windows, you have to examine your state's Department of Motor Vehicles to learn more about the regulations, including the legal visible light transmission (VLT) degrees

State regulations may change yearly. Respectable window tinting firms worked with to install aftermarket color movie will be acquainted with the guidelines in your area. Your conformity with the legislation for car window tinting might change if you relocate to an additional state. Many states give vehicle window tinting exceptions for chauffeurs with a legit clinical or vision-related requirement to restrict their direct exposure to sunlight.
Typically, vehicle drivers with sunshine level of sensitivity might obtain an authorization, waiver, or exemption from the state's tinting regulation with the Department of Electric Motor Vehicles. The driver must submit the application with paperwork supporting the clinical necessity for tinted home windows - window tinting. There isn't a straightforward response due to the fact that lots of elements will influence auto home window tinting costs. Among them are: Your area. The top quality and kind of tint you want to set up. The version of your automobile. Quantity of glass space requiring color. In extremely general terms, and relying on the quality and functions of the product made use of, car window tinting costs for a car can be $250 to $500.

You can buy auto home window color movie by the roll. Some makers offer do it yourself home window color sets that come pre-cut for certain car designs. The installment method is simple, yet the job needs a considerable amount of persistence, careful interest to detail, and a degree of ability that follows lots of method.
High-quality, multiple-ply ceramic film can last 10 to 15 years and usually has a life time service warranty. Service warranties generally cover gurgling, fracturing, and peeling. Any type of item assurances may need installation by shops or technicians certified by the tint supplier. Make sure to complete the tint guarantee paperwork after installment and keep all receipts and info from the store.
